在Python中打开.csv文件的正确方式是使用csv模块进行操作。csv模块提供了一种简单的方式来读取和写入.csv文件。
以下是正确的打开.csv文件的步骤:
import csv
导入csv模块。open()
函数打开.csv文件,并指定文件路径和打开模式。例如,with open('file.csv', 'r') as csvfile:
表示以只读模式打开名为file.csv的文件。csv.reader()
函数创建一个csv读取器对象。将打开的文件对象作为参数传递给该函数。例如,csvreader = csv.reader(csvfile)
。csvreader
对象的next()
方法或for
循环逐行读取.csv文件的内容。例如,row = csvreader.next()
或for row in csvreader:
。完整的代码示例:
import csv
with open('file.csv', 'r') as csvfile:
csvreader = csv.reader(csvfile)
for row in csvreader:
print(row)
在这个例子中,我们使用csv.reader()
函数创建了一个csv读取器对象csvreader
,然后使用for
循环逐行读取.csv文件的内容,并打印每一行的数据。
请注意,这只是打开.csv文件的基本方式,你可以根据具体需求进行进一步的操作,如写入数据、指定分隔符等。
推荐的腾讯云相关产品:腾讯云对象存储(COS),用于存储和管理大规模的非结构化数据。产品介绍链接地址:https://cloud.tencent.com/product/cos
领取专属 10元无门槛券
手把手带您无忧上云